Etymology[edit]

granat +‎ äpple, from Latin pomum granatum (pomegranate), an apple with many seeds. Used in Swedish since 1541.

Noun[edit]

granatäpple n

  1. a pomegranate (fruit and tree)
    • 1541, Swedish Bible translation, Song of Songs 4:13
      En Lustgård aff Granatäple medh ädhla fruchter.
      an orchard of pomegranates, with pleasant fruits
